      I think it would be really helpful to have tools we can use to not only compare model forecasts with each other, as we already can, but to also compare the past predictions with what the true weather turned out to be. In my case, even though ECMWF seems to be the more "highly respected" model, I have subjectively noticed that GFS seems to have generally more accurate in the particular area I usually sail in. I can't confirm this intuitive observation with data, though, and that's what I'd like to be able to do.

      What I'd like to be able to do is pick a location and a time/date and see what the actual recorded weather conditions were vs. the forecasts 1, 3, 5, and 7 days prior. Some limitations to save storage would be perfectly understandable. E.g. perhaps a max of 90 days of past data, with decreasing resolution further back in that window, Round Robin Database-style.

      This data might be useful to Windy.com, as well. Patterns might emerge over time where you could provide heatmaps of which models tend to be accurate more often in specific regions. That additional guidance would be a great value-add for users.

        The feature Forecast vs observation. is already available in Windy.
        Select Reported wind or Reported temperature to choose a weather station in your area. It is better to choose a professional weather station, wmo or ad (airport) labelled.
        Then you can compare the model predictions during the last days and the weather station observations:
